Sql server cdc.

Requires VIEW DATABASE STATE permission to query the sys.dm_cdc_errors dynamic management view. For more information about permissions on dynamic management views, see Dynamic Management Views and Functions (Transact-SQL). Permissions for SQL Server 2022 and later. Requires VIEW DATABASE …

Sql server cdc. Things To Know About Sql server cdc.

Feb 28, 2023 · cdc.captured_columns (Transact-SQL) Returns one row for each column tracked in a captured instance. By default, all columns of the source table are captured. However, columns can be included or excluded when the source table is enabled for change data capture by specifying a column list. 有关 Azure SQL 数据库,请参阅 CDC 与 Azure SQL 数据库。 权限. 需要具有 sysadmin 权限才能为 SQL Server 和 Azure SQL 托管实例启用或禁用变更数据捕获。 为某个数据库禁用. 你必须先为数据库启用变更数据捕获,然后才能为各个表创建捕获实例。 要启用变更数据捕获,请 ...O SQL Server 2022 Express é uma edição gratuita do SQL Server, ideal para desenvolvimento e produção de aplicações de área de trabalho, Web e pequenos servidores. Baixe agora. PASS Data Community Summit – Uma conferência híbrida em Seattle e online, de 15 a 18 de novembro. Saiba mais.Some versions of SQL Server don't order these correctly. Fully patched systems shouldn't have a problem, though. This column is not available in the output of the generated functions, which the official documentation says you should use .

Oct 19, 2010 · When you apply CDC to a table, all DML (inserts, updates, and deletes) issued to the table are tracked in a second table automatically created by SQL Server. Internally, SQL Server tracks all DML ... Remarks. sys.sp_cdc_disable_db disables change data capture for all tables in the database currently enabled. All system objects related to change data capture, such as change tables, jobs, stored procedures and functions, are dropped. The is_cdc_enabled column for the database entry in the sys.databases catalog view is set to 0.19 Feb 2014 ... Comments5 · MSSQL - Change Data Capture Update Mask Explained · MSSQL - How to set up Transactional Replication Step by Step · You Thought You ...

I found a solution where I can copy old CDC table values into a temp table, then disable CDC and then enable CDC with new table schema. Later copying the temp table values into new CDC table and updating the LSN value. Instead of the above I need a solution where I can include the new column into the CDC table while the CDC is enabled.

Autenticação do SQL Server: se você selecionar esta opção, deverá digitar o Nome de Usuário e a Senha para o usuário no SQL Server ao qual você está se conectando. Para preparar a instância do SQL Server para Oracle CDC, o logon deve ter permissão de gravação no banco de dados MSXDBCDC. Insira as credenciais para um logon que tem ...We outlined what it takes to implement SQL Server CDC to Kafka using Debezium and the alternative and easier route of using Arcion. Both were explained in detail, including the setup and commands it would take to configure both platforms. We also went in-depth on the Arcion features that bring convenience and quality to the SQL …Change data capture in a read-only replica. I have a SQL Server instance, and a read-only replica of that instance that is used for ETL and analytics pipelines. The source instance has change data capture (CDC) enabled. What are best practices around propagating CDC to the replica so that e.g.If your intent is to do real auditing CDC is not built for that, its more for synchronizing changes than it is for auditing for a long term, unless you setup jobs to pull the data over into audit tables like you would with a triggered solution. You don't mention the new Server Audit Specifications here, which would be another option to look at ...

To control behavior of CDC in a database, use native SQL Server procedures such as sp_cdc_enable_table and sp_cdc_start_job. To change CDC job parameters, like maxtrans and maxscans, you can use sp_cdc_change_job.. To get more information regarding the CDC jobs, you can query the following dynamic management views:

4 Nov 2013 ... Make sure SQL Server Agent is running. · To enable the feature on the database, open the Enable Database for CDC template in the Configuration ...

Are you looking to enhance your SQL skills but find it challenging to practice in a traditional classroom setting? Look no further. With online SQL practice, you can learn at your ...19 Nov 2023 ... Discover how to effortlessly set up a CDC pipeline from SQL Server to Snowflake using Upsolver. This video demonstrates the ease of ...CDC in sql server. 2. SQL Server - View a specific log entry in transaction log file (ldf) 3. Function sys.fn_cdc_get_max_lsn() returns null. 0. Cdc and how long are logs kept. 2. Not all LSNs map to dates. 0. CDC LSNs: queries return different minimum value. 3.SQL Server CDC is a powerful feature in Microsoft SQL Server that enables organizations to efficiently capture and track changes made to their database ...Instead, you can query the CDC.fn_cdc_get_all_changes system function related to the SQL Server CDC-enabled table as shown: Image Source Step 5 : The CDC.fn_cdc_get_all_changes function can be queried as long as you provide the @row_filter_option , @from_lsn , and @to_lsn parameters.In order to ensure data reliability and minimize the risk of data loss, it is essential for database administrators to regularly perform full backups of their SQL Server databases....

Autenticação do SQL Server: se você selecionar esta opção, deverá digitar o Nome de Usuário e a Senha para o usuário no SQL Server ao qual você está se conectando. Para preparar a instância do SQL Server para Oracle CDC, o logon deve ter permissão de gravação no banco de dados MSXDBCDC. Insira as credenciais para um logon que tem ...Remarks. sys.sp_cdc_scan is called internally by sys.sp_MScdc_capture_job if the SQL Server Agent capture job is being used by change data capture. The procedure can't be executed explicitly when a change data capture log scan operation is already active, or when the database is enabled for transactional replication.I found a solution where I can copy old CDC table values into a temp table, then disable CDC and then enable CDC with new table schema. Later copying the temp table values into new CDC table and updating the LSN value. Instead of the above I need a solution where I can include the new column into the CDC table while the CDC is enabled.Neste artigo. Quais databases estão com o CDC ativo? Quais tabelas estão sendo monitoradas com CDC? Como habilitar o CDC em um database (Nível 1) Como ativar o CDC e monitorar alterações nas tabelas (Nível …May 1, 2023 · Here's how to do it using SQL Server Management Studio: Open SQL Server Management Studio. Navigate to View > Template Explorer > SQL Server Templates. Select the Change Data Capture sub-folder to access the templates. Use the "Enable Database for CDC template" and run it within your desired database. Step I.2. Enabling CDC For Specific Tables High-level solution. In this tutorial, you create a pipeline that performs the following operations: Create a lookup activity to count the number of changed records in the SQL Database CDC table and pass it to an IF Condition activity.; Create an If Condition to check whether there are changed records and if so, invoke the copy activity.; Create a copy activity to copy the …Jun 14, 2023 · Indicates whether the capture job is to run continuously ( 1 ), or run only once ( 0 ). @continuous is bit with a default of 1. When @continuous is 1, the sp_cdc_scan job scans the log and processes up to ( @maxtrans * @maxscans) transactions. It then waits the number of seconds specified in @pollinginterval before beginning the next log scan.

CDC is now available in public preview in Azure SQL, enabling customers to track data changes on their Azure SQL Database tables in near real-time. Now in public preview, CDC in PaaS offers similar functionality to SQL Server and Azure SQL Managed Instance CDC, providing a scheduler which automatically runs change capture and …

sys.sp_cdc_start_job can be used by an administrator to explicitly start either the capture job or the cleanup job. Permissions. Requires membership in the db_owner fixed database role. Examples A. Start a capture job. The following example starts the capture job for the AdventureWorks2022 database.CDC doesn't support the values for computed columns even if the computed column is defined as persisted. Computed columns that are included in a capture instance always have a value of NULL. This behavior is intended, and not a bug. Linux. CDC is supported for SQL Server 2017 on Linux starting with CU18, and SQL Server 2019 on Linux. See AlsoJun 25, 2021 · The associated change table (cdc.dbo_MyTable_CT) will be created, along with the capture and cleanup jobs (cdc.cdc_jobs). Be aware that in Azure SQL Databases, capture and cleanup are run by the scheduler, while in SQL Server and Azure SQL Managed Instance they are run by the SQL Server Agent. 3. CDC doesn't support the values for computed columns even if the computed column is defined as persisted. Computed columns that are included in a capture instance always have a value of NULL. This behavior is intended, and not a bug. Linux. CDC is supported for SQL Server 2017 on Linux starting with CU18, and SQL Server 2019 on Linux. See AlsoIn this article. Applies to: SQL Server Returns one row for each change applied to the source table within the specified log sequence number (LSN) range. If a source row had multiple changes during the interval, each change is represented in the returned result set.Mar 27, 2023 · The CDC source reads a range of change data from SQL Server change tables and delivers the changes downstream to other SSIS components. The range of change data read by the CDC source is called the CDC Processing Range and is determine by the CDC Control task that is executed before the current data flow starts. cdc.index_columns (Transact-SQL) Returns one row for each index column associated with a change table. The index columns are used by change data capture to uniquely identify rows in the source table. By default, the columns of the primary key of the source table are included. However, if a unique index on the source table is specified …cdc.index_columns – contains a row for each index column associated with a change table. The index columns are used to uniquely identify rows in …

CDC in sql server. 2. SQL Server - View a specific log entry in transaction log file (ldf) 3. Function sys.fn_cdc_get_max_lsn() returns null. 0. Cdc and how long are logs kept. 2. Not all LSNs map to dates. 0. CDC LSNs: queries return different minimum value. 3.

3 Aug 2023 ... Remember that data in CDC change tables are retained based on user-configured settings. So, before making any changes to column size, you must ...

Considerando que o melhor processamento é aquele que não existe, Habilitar o CDC no SQL Server, embora com pouco impacto de performance, pode ter incremento de utilização de CPU, mas a magnitude desse impacto depende de vários fatores, como o volume de alterações e a capacidade de hardware do servidor. É recomendável realizar testes de …When you open the CDC Designer Console, the Connect to SQL Server dialog box opens. The SQL Server login that accesses the CDC Designer must have UPDATE permissions on the MSXDBCDC database. In addition, the login must also have the dbcreator fixed-server role to create new Oracle CDC Instances. It is recommended that the login also …Sep 26, 2023 · Show 2 more. Applies to: SQL Server Azure SQL Database Azure SQL Managed Instance. SQL Server provides two features that track changes to data in a database: change data capture and change tracking. These features enable applications to determine the DML changes (insert, update, and delete operations) that were made to user tables in a database. Is there a way to 100% automate SQL Server CDC initialization in an active SQL Server database? I am trying to solve a problem finding from_lsn during first cdc data capture. Sequence of events: Enable CDC on given database/Table; Copy full table to destination (Data lake)The Oracle CDC Instance is a process created by the Oracle CDC Service to process changes captured from a single Oracle source database. The Oracle CDC Instance retrieves its configuration from the cdc.xdbcdc_config table and maintains its state in the cdc.xdbcdc_state table. These tables are part of the CDC database, which defines the Oracle ...Feb 28, 2023 · The name of the SQL Server login used by the Oracle CDC Service to connect to the SQL Server instance. A new SQL User named cdc_service is created and associated with this login name and is then added as a member of the db_ddladmin, db_datareader and db_datawriter fixed database roles for each CDC database handled by the service. ref_count Applies to: SQL Server. Change data capture records insert, update, and delete activity applied to SQL Server tables, supplying the details of the changes in an easily consumed relational format. Column information that mirrors the column structure of a tracked source table is captured for the modified rows, along with the metadata needed to ...Use the CONCAT function to concatenate together two strings or fields using the syntax CONCAT(expression1, expression2). Though concatenation can also be performed using the || (do...We can set up a simple streaming pipeline to ingest CDC events from SQL Server to Kafka using Debezium and Kafka Connect. I would say it was a fairly easy setup, but it does a very and complex job.Oct 26, 2023 · 本文介绍 CDC 如何与 SQL Server 和 Azure SQL 托管实例配合使用。 有关 Azure SQL 数据库,请参阅 CDC 与 Azure SQL 数据库。 概述. 变更数据捕获使用 SQL Server 代理记录表中发生的插入、更新及删除。 因此,它使得可以通过关系格式轻松使用这些数据更改。 Edition Definition; Enterprise: The premium offering, SQL Server Enterprise edition delivers comprehensive high-end datacenter capabilities with blazing-fast performance, unlimited virtualization 1, and end-to-end business intelligence, enabling high service levels for mission-critical workloads and end-user access to data insights. Enterprise edition is available …

sys.sp_cdc_stop_job can be used by an administrator to explicitly stop either the capture job or the cleanup job. Permissions. Requires membership in the db_owner fixed database role. Examples. The following example stops the capture job for the AdventureWorks2022 database. USE AdventureWorks2022; GO EXEC …Edition Definition; Enterprise: The premium offering, SQL Server Enterprise edition delivers comprehensive high-end datacenter capabilities with blazing-fast performance, unlimited virtualization 1, and end-to-end business intelligence, enabling high service levels for mission-critical workloads and end-user access to data insights. Enterprise edition is available …Use the CONCAT function to concatenate together two strings or fields using the syntax CONCAT(expression1, expression2). Though concatenation can also be performed using the || (do...CDC can be easily implemented in SQL Server. SQL Server 2005 & above has features of executing ‘after update’, ‘after insert’ and ‘after delete’ triggers that can be used for data archiving and data capturing without any additional programming. This link specifies how to implement CDC in SQL Server database.Instagram:https://instagram. bedias bankmy service providerelan creditmaspeth savings bank 30 Oct 2017 ... This video demonstrates on how to configure SQL Server Change Data Capture or CDC for SSIS. It gives you an overview of various system ...31 Oct 2018 ... In this short video, we walk through the steps to setup change data capture using on SQL Server with the StreamSets Data Collector change ... faithful workoutslogin form In this article. Change data capture enables change tracking on tables so that data manipulation language (DML) and data definition language (DDL) changes made to the tables can be incrementally loaded into a data warehouse. The articles in this section describe the system tables that store information used by change data capture operations.Ensuring security is crucial when implementing Change Data Capture (CDC) in SQL Server. By following best practices for security and permissions, you can safeguard sensitive data and protect the ... money watching Aplica-se a: SQL Server. Desabilita a captura de dados de alteração (CDC) para o banco de dados atual. A captura de dados de alteração não está disponível em todas as edições do SQL Server. Para obter uma lista de recursos com suporte nas edições do SQL Server, confira Edições e recursos com suporte no SQL Server 2022.3 Feb 2023 ... Comments6 · 103. CDC(change data capture) for SQL Source in Mapping data flows in Azure Data Factory or Synapse · 7. Remove Duplicate Rows using ....変更データ キャプチャ (CDC) では、SQL Server エージェントを使用して、テーブルで発生した挿入、更新、削除をログに記録します。 そのため、リレーショナル形式を使用して簡単に使用できるように、これらのデータ変更にアクセスできるようになりま …